A Chinese blue and white silver-mounted 'kraak porselein' teapot and cover
Wanli (1573-1619), the silver later
The barrel-shaped teapot with ribbed sides and panels of peony alternated with panels enclosing symbols, with silver swing overhead handle, the neck, cover and short curving spout mounted in silver, cover restored
16 cm. high
Together with a pair of Chinese blue and white silver-mounted jars and silver covers, Kangxi (1662-1722), the silver later, each painted to the oviform sides with 'Long Eliza's' in a fenced garden landscape, the silver covers with floral finial, 17 cm. high (3)
